CSL, a pharmaceutical company, has a beta of 1.5, and Woolworths has a beta of 0.9. The risk-free rate of interest is 4% and the market risk premium is 7%. What is the expected return on a portfolio with 30% of its money in CSL and the balance in Woolworths?
